Profile
Manufactures flow-control and protection products, boilers and water heaters, drainage systems, and water-quality equipment for buildings. Earns almost all revenue from product sales across the Americas, Europe, and APMEA, with wholesalers as the largest channel and regulated plumbing and building codes shaping demand.
Designs and manufactures products that manage water and energy flows through commercial, residential, and light-industrial buildings. The portfolio spans backflow preventers, pressure regulators, mixing and relief valves, leak-detection systems, commercial washroom and emergency-safety equipment, boilers and water heaters, radiant heating controls, gas connectors, drainage and water-reuse systems, and water filtration, monitoring, conditioning, and scale prevention.
Operates through Americas, Europe, and APMEA segments, with the Americas generating most sales. Integrated manufacturing and smart monitoring and control capabilities support sales through plumbing and heating wholesalers, OEMs, specialty distributors, dealers, and retailers. Recent acquisitions expanded boilers, emergency safety, drainage, and water quality.
Most revenue comes from product sales, wholesale distribution is the primary channel, and a majority of products are subject to plumbing, building, water-quality, and energy-efficiency standards.

Peers
- Zurn Elkay Water Solutions
Pure-play rival across backflow, pressure, drainage, and washroom.
- A. O. Smith
Directly contests Watts AERCO and PVI in commercial boilers and water heaters.
- Pentair
Overlaps in water filtration, flow control, and residential water treatment.
- Mueller Water Products
Competes on iron gate valves and pressure management in water infrastructure.
- Xylem
Applied Water segment overlaps in hydronic heating and building water systems.
